first responder vs. EMT

[furst ri-spon-der] / ˈfɜrst rɪˈspɒn dər /

noun

  1. a person who is certified to provide medical care in emergencies before more highly trained medical personnel arrive on the scene.

    a firefighter trained as a first responder.

EMT
  1. emergency medical technician: a person who is trained to give emergency medical care at the scene of an accident or in an ambulance.
